To make London broil in the Instant Pot from frozen, season and marinate the piece of meat before freezing. Then place the frozen London broil in the Instant Pot with sufficient liquid, and pressure cook on high for 30 minutes. Natural pressure release for 10 minutes, then quick release the remaining pressure.

The cooking time for London Broil in the Instant Pot will depend on the thickness of the meat and how well done you prefer it. As a general rule of thumb, for a medium-rare London Broil, cook it under high pressure for approximately 5-7 minutes per pound. Increase the cooking time by a few minutes for a medium or well-done result.

As a general rule of thumb, you'll want to cook your london broil for 15 minutes per pound on high pressure mode. For example, if you have a 3-pound london broil, you'll want to cook it for 45 minutes on high pressure. Once your cooking time is up, allow the pressure to release naturally for 10-15 minutes before opening the pot.
